Moving the goalposts . . .

Blackwell may have to move its goalposts to solve the problem of unwanted football matches being played.

The parish council heard that an adult team from outside the area had been using the pitch opposite Blackwell First School after the council installed goals there in the spring. Coun Janet King said: “No one know where they come from; it is a young adult team with a referee. They arrive in their cars and they leave litter and use language that’s not entirely savoury for the park.

“The school does see it as a problem. I think if they are using it on a regular basis they should be paying, but they are not being controlled at all.”

Coun King said the school was all for moving the goalposts closer together so that the pitch wasn’t big enough for the interlopers’ standard of football.
